EVs made speed cheap, but they ruined the fun of driving

Driving used to be something more than just a way to get from one place to another. Just taking a drive down to the store could be an exciting experience in the right car. The so-called "driver's car", which emphasizes feedback and responsiveness to your inputs was a great way to forget about your dull 9-5 life. For those who cared about such things, there were plenty of choices at every budget level. These days? I'm starting to doubt that a true driver's car even exists anymore in any form.
